Bellinger is batting .271 with 25 doubles, five triples, 29 home runs and 50 walks. Among batters in MLB, Bellinger ranks 27th in home runs and 14th in RBI.

He is 10-8 with a 4.39 ERA and 100 Ks through 149 2/3 innings pitched.The righty last pitched on Saturday, Sept. 13 against the Toronto Blue Jays, when he lasted six innings, allowing one earned run while giving up four hits.The 35-year-old has put up an ERA of 4.39, with 6 strikeouts per nine innings in 28 contests this year. Opposing hitters have a .273 batting average against him.Sugano has posted 10 quality starts this season.
